Snowfall will taper off on Monday, but moderate winds will continue to build wind slabs on lee aspects. Avoid steep slopes below corniced ridgelines, the base of cliffs, and confined rocky features where triggering a wind slab is most likely. On northerly aspects, wind slabs rest over weak, faceted snow from the January Drought, so avalanches may be much larger and more dangerous. Shooting cracks, collapsing, or fresh avalanches are all red flags that the snow is unstable.
Wind slabs and fresh snow fell on inconsistent and variable surfaces, including slick crusts, wind-stiffened snow, and weak, faceted snow. The variability in both deeper weak layers and surfaces makes the distribution of triggering avalanches tricky to forecast. So, while you can make observations using test slopes and hand pits to observe how the new snow reacts, don't try to extrapolate your results to nearby slopes. Give these wind slabs some extra space and time to heal.
